I’ve made a number of videos about tier points and about getting status and I’m closing in on the end of my status year with British Airways which will bring an end to my Gold Status with them. I’ve been studying the various options I have to gather enough tier points to renew my status, but nothing has been really screaming to me as being the right option…
So in this video I’ll talk about 6 ways of gathering tier points that you might consider with a view to efficiently getting status on British Airways. And I’ll reveal what I am currently planning to do…

I'm not chasing BA status yet but I looked into it as someone who is based in the US and likes to visit Asia. In addition to domestic first class in the US, I've found it's also possible to get 40 tier points at less than 2 British pounds per point on quite a few domestic routes on Japan Airlines in class J.

But I would like to add a cautious note regarding CX business class, a class P business ticket could get you 0 TP, and the CX webpage do not show you the fare class until you purchased the ticket (the mobile app will work, but only for a return ticket, no multi-city). A class P isn't even a Business Light as they called their cheapest ticket. My way is to check the ticket side-by-side with Expedia where they always provides the fare class. Nonetheless, there's still the risk that it might not be the same ticket.
